SISCO HART communicators significantly enhance the effectiveness of plant maintenance strategies by enabling real-time diagnostics and predictive monitoring of field devices. Unlike traditional analog-only systems, where fault detection often relies on manual inspections or output deviations, HART-capable devices communicate detailed health status, error codes, calibration drift, and environmental conditions to the communicator. With this information readily accessible in the field, maintenance teams can quickly identify and resolve issues—such as sensor fouling, valve stiction, or power supply fluctuations—before they lead to process failures or safety incidents. This capability supports a shift from reactive to predictive maintenance, extending the lifespan of critical instrumentation and reducing unscheduled downtime. Additionally, SISCO HART communicators facilitate documentation by storing configuration data and diagnostics logs, which can be exported for audits or integrated into plant asset management software.
